diff options
author | Jean-Marie Traissard <jim@lapin.org> | 2007-02-01 17:51:14 +0300 |
---|---|---|
committer | Jean-Marie Traissard <jim@lapin.org> | 2007-02-01 17:51:14 +0300 |
commit | f6a0fe472447c7f142a699b36e4f50f271deff6d (patch) | |
tree | d7f2a09bdb254a5d62c10d4e7690e6175e13d791 | |
parent | 32ca86db037cb7f0dba19b4d2d18b9fb99a4b43c (diff) |
Don't store avatar sha until we really have avatar. Fixes #2956.
-rw-r--r-- | ChangeLog | 3 | ||||
-rw-r--r-- | src/common/connection_handlers.py | 1 |
2 files changed, 3 insertions, 1 deletions
@@ -1,3 +1,6 @@ +Gajim 0.11.1 (XX February 2007) + * Fixed avatars cache problems in group chats + Gajim 0.11 (19 December 2006) * New build system, using GNU autotools. See README.html * Support for link-local messaging via Zeroconf using Avahi (XEP-0174) diff --git a/src/common/connection_handlers.py b/src/common/connection_handlers.py index d2959faff..7488f5659 100644 --- a/src/common/connection_handlers.py +++ b/src/common/connection_handlers.py @@ -1685,7 +1685,6 @@ class ConnectionHandlers(ConnectionVcard, ConnectionBytestream, ConnectionDisco, if cached_sha != self.vcard_shas[who]: # avatar has been updated self.request_vcard(who) - self.vcard_shas[who] = avatar_sha self.dispatch('GC_NOTIFY', (jid_stripped, show, status, resource, prs.getRole(), prs.getAffiliation(), prs.getJid(), prs.getReason(), prs.getActor(), prs.getStatusCode(), |